We've had a busy week on the road catching geese for #BirdRinging with 1,577 birds caught in 12 catches. Please keep an eye open for yellow & blue leg rings & white neck collars, and report sightings to waterbirdcolourmarking.org (Thread 👇🏻)

The beautiful Kingfisher caught at yesterdays CES @Pensthorpe. If you look closely at the feet you’ll see they are dark brown telling us this bird is a juvenile as adults have bright orange feet 👣
